Authorities believe it was an accident
Authorities say a boy was injured after getting struck by a pellet, Monday afternoon.
Ross County Sheriff George Lavender says the situation appears accidental, and preliminary investigations led authorities to believe that the boy was shooting a pellet gun when a pellet ricocheted back and hit him in the head, causing him to fall and hit his head on the ground.
He was flown from the Bainbridge area to a Columbus hospital with concussion-like symptoms.
